I installed Windows 10 on a 2TB HDD (MBR) in a PC with a GA-P67A-UD4-B3 Motherboard.
Works fine until I add a GPT HDD then the system will not boot.
If I add GPT HDDs once Windows is running there is no problem. However that is hardly ideal.
Is there any way round this problem?
Is there any prospect of an EFI upgrade for this board?

Greetings,
Afraid not. While GPT formatted disks are possible for data, booting from them is not be supported. GPT formatted boot drives require a UEFI BIOS.
Thank you.
Discovered that so long as the MBR drive is first in the boot list then all ok.
